What is the difference between Animal Trapping vs Pest Control Technician?
| Aspect | Animal Trapping | Pest Control Technician |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| May require wildlife handling permits or licenses | Requires pesticide applicator licenses |
| Work Environment | Outdoor, wildlife habitats, residential and commercial properties | Indoor and outdoor, residential, commercial, and industrial sites |
| Industry Usage | Wildlife management, pest control, property preservation | Pest elimination, prevention, and treatment services |
| Common Search/Comparison | Yes | No |
Animal Trapping and Pest Control Technician roles often overlap in managing unwanted animals or pests. Animal Trapping focuses on capturing wildlife using specialized traps, often requiring permits, while Pest Control Technicians primarily use chemical treatments to eliminate pests. Both roles are essential in property preservation and require knowledge of safety protocols and industry regulations.

White Oak conserves and sustains some of the earth's rarest wild animals through innovative training, research, education, and conservation breeding programs that contribute to the survival of wildlife in nature. The conservation programs span 600 acres along the St. Mary's River in northeast Florida, surrounded by 22,000 acres of mixed forest and wetlands that make up the beautiful White Oak property. Founded in 1982, White Oak leads professional efforts to improve veterinary care, develop holistic animal management techniques, and better understand the biology of critically endangered species by providing excellent care and managing conservation programs for over 30 species of imperiled wildlife in large, naturalistic habitats.
White Oak Mission:
Saving endangered wildlife and habitats through sustainable populations, expanding education initiatives, and responsible land stewardship.
Job Summary:
The Conservation and Recovery Specialist will perform as a member of the White Oak team to achieve exceptional animal care and facility care standards in their area of focus to sustain and grow White Oak's species recovery programs and achieve its conservation goals. This position is focused on avian and canid recovery programs, with possible engagement with other taxa, such as amphibians.
Essential Duties:
o Participates in the daily care of the animals to promote a naturally enriching environment; including diet preparation, feeding, cleaning, medicating, observing, and training.
o Participates in animal restraint, incubation/hatching, animal transfers, introductions, operant conditioning, assisted-reproduction in cranes, and passerine mist-netting.
o Participates in and assists with area research projects.
o Maintains and cares for surrounding areas to ensure a natural environment and ecological health.
o Fosters department delivery of guest engagement programs featuring wildlife populations.
o Assists veterinarian staff with animal care procedures, treatments and sample collection, as directed by area supervisor.
o Keeps Florida grasshopper sparrow breeding documents up to date throughout breeding season.
o Creates hatch, nest fail and other breeding related calendar alerts to help monitor diet changes and consumption, as well as to monitor breeding behavior.
o Notifies supervisor of facility maintenance, equipment, supplies, and animal feed needs.
o Assists with minor animal care facilities maintenance including: mowing, weed eating, netting, pressure washing, dirt and substrate work, limb pick up, and minor repairs.
o Organizes, preps, and conducts controlled burns on property.
o Prepares burn plans for controlled burns conducted on property; documents action reports.
o Maintains records and reports related to wildlife.
o Collects, maintains, organizes, and assembles data and spreadsheets for accurate analysis.
o Assists Leads with program data and statistical analysis for scientific publications.
o Maintains, cleans and organizes work and break areas, food storage, food prep, vehicles and equipment.
o Conducts camera trapping operation, maintenance, and review.
o Conducts the daily care of several invertebrate prey species and collection of wild invertebrate prey species.
o Observes and ensures area safety protocol, safe vehicle and equipment operation.
o Applies herbicide application and performs other needed pest management activities.
o Assists with intern training and mentoring.
o Participates in trainings including animal husbandry and management, ZIMS record keeping, research, conservation and recovery projects, chainsaw operation, venomous snake handling, and other education projects.
